Meaning of commelinaceae

Wordnet

commelinaceae (n)

large widely distributed family of chiefly perennial herbs or climbers: spiderworts

Commelinaceae is a family of flowering plants known for their diverse and colorful blooms.

The Commelinaceae family includes various genera such as Tradescantia and Commelina.

Many members of the Commelinaceae family are cultivated as ornamental plants in gardens and landscapes.

Commelinaceae plants are characterized by their simple, alternate leaves and distinctive flower structures.
